UPDF Kicks Off National Recruitment Exercise in Karamoja Sub-Region

The Uganda Peoples’ Defence Forces (UPDF) has commenced the 2024 national recruitment exercise in the Karamoja Sub-region, with all shortlisted candidates from Kaabong and Karenga districts present to undergo the selection process.

 

Col James Barigye Rukundo, Team Leader and substantive 3 Division Operations and Training Officer (3 DOTO), addressed the aspiring candidates, urging them to maintain discipline, follow instructions, and exercise patience throughout the interview process. He assured the candidates and district leadership that the interview stages would be systematic, transparent, and fair, with the goal of selecting worthy soldiers upon completion of training programmes.

 

Col Rukundo emphasised that the UPDF would uphold its dignity and maintain its standards throughout the process.

 

Mr. Ocailap Filbert, Resident District Commissioner (RDC) for Karenga, expressed gratitude to the UPDF leadership for adopting a new approach to shortlisting candidates based on official adverts and projected quotas, providing guidance and clarity.

 

The District Chairperson of Kaabong, Meri Jino, advocated for affirmative action for candidates from the Karamoja Sub-region.

 

The recruitment team will spend two days at the Kaabong recruitment centre, aiming to select 22 candidates from the 36 shortlisted for Kaabong district and 12 from the 14 shortlisted for Karenga district. The team will conduct a similar exercise at the Kotido centre on 3 July 2024 for candidates from Kotido district and on 4 July 2024 for those from Abim district.

 

Present were Capt (Rtd) Chris Mike Okirya, RDC for Kaabong, and local leaders.
